What is the default behavior of columns in the Top Down approach regarding nullability?

Prepare for the Appian Senior Developer Test with our comprehensive quiz. Test your skills with flashcards and multiple choice questions, each with helpful hints and explanations. Ace your exam!

In the Top Down approach, the design philosophy often emphasizes flexibility and adaptability to business needs. This means that most columns in the initial design are not mandated to be required. It allows for optional data entry, which can be particularly useful in scenarios where not all fields need to be populated for a record to be meaningful.

Having non-required fields promotes a more user-friendly experience, as it enables users to submit incomplete data when full information is not available, aligning closely with agile development practices. Therefore, the default behavior leaning towards non-required columns supports iterative development, allowing enhancements and changes to be made as business requirements evolve.

In contrast, the notion that all columns or most columns should be required by default would impose constraints that could hinder flexibility in initial design stages. The option suggesting no effect on nullability is misleading, as there is indeed a default stance concerning column requirements, significantly influencing data integrity and user input expectations.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y